jQuery 是一个广泛使用的 JavaScript 库,它使得 JavaScript 开发变得更加简单和高效。在使用 jQuery 进行开发时,你可能会注意到一个常见的现象:很多 jQuery 代码...
jQuery 是一个广泛使用的 JavaScript 库,它使得 JavaScript 开发变得更加简单和高效。在使用 jQuery 进行开发时,你可能会注意到一个常见的现象:很多 jQuery 代码都是大写的。本文将揭秘 jQuery 大写之谜,并分享一些代码规范与技巧。
在 jQuery 中,大多数选择器、事件和函数都是大写的。这种做法有几个原因:
jQuery 选择器(如 $("#id")、$(".class")、$("div"))应该使用大写。这是因为选择器是 jQuery 特有的,而 JavaScript 中的变量和函数名通常使用小写。
// 正确
$("#id")
$(".class")
$("div")
// 错误
$("#Id")
$(".Class")
$("DIV")jQuery 的事件处理函数(如 .click()、.hover()、.on())也应该使用大写。这是因为事件是 jQuery 特有的,而 JavaScript 中的函数名通常使用小写。
// 正确
$("#button").click(function() { // 代码
});
// 错误
$("#button").click(function() { // 代码
});
$("#button").on("hover", function() { // 代码
});jQuery 函数(如 $.ajax()、$.each()、$.trim())应该使用大写。这是因为函数是 jQuery 特有的,而 JavaScript 中的函数名通常使用小写。
// 正确
$.ajax({ url: "example.com", method: "GET", success: function(data) { // 代码 }
});
// 错误
$ajax({ url: "example.com", method: "GET", success: function(data) { // 代码 }
});为了提高代码的可读性,建议使用缩进。通常,每个缩进级别使用两个空格。
$("#button").click(function() { var name = "John"; console.log(name);
});在代码中添加注释可以帮助其他开发者(或未来的你)更好地理解代码。注释应该清晰、简洁,并描述代码的功能。
// 点击按钮后显示消息
$("#button").click(function() { alert("Hello, world!");
});jQuery 大写之谜主要源于一致性、可读性和命名空间的原因。通过遵循上述代码规范和技巧,你可以编写更加清晰、易读和可维护的 jQuery 代码。